#ifndef __TS_TYPES__
#define __TS_TYPES__
#include <stdlib.h>
#include <inttypes.h>
typedef unsigned char uint8;
typedef unsigned short uint16;
typedef unsigned int uint32;
typedef signed char sint8;
typedef signed short sint16;
typedef signed int sint32;
#ifdef _WIN32
typedef unsigned __int64 uint64;
typedef signed __int64 uint64;
#else
typedef unsigned long long uint64;
typedef signed long long sint64;
#endif
#define true 1
#define false 0
#define INVALID_VAL -1
#define TS_PKT_LEN 188
#define TS_SYNC_BYTE 0x47
#define STUFFING_BYTE 0xFF
#define PES_START_CODE 0x010000 // PES分组起始标志0x000001
#define CRC32_LEN 4
#define HDR_LEN_NOT_INCLUDE 3 // PAT/PMT中包含section length字段的头长度
#define PID_PAT 0x0000
#define PID_CAT 0x0001
#define PID_TSDT 0x0002
#define PID_DVB_NIT 0x0010
#define PID_DVB_SDT 0x0011
#define PID_DVB_EIT 0x0012
#define PID_DVB_RST 0x0013
#define PID_DVB_TDT 0x0014
#define PID_DVB_SYNC 0x0015
#define PID_DVB_INBAND 0x001c
#define PID_DVB_MEASUREMENT 0x001d
#define PID_DVB_DIT 0x001e
#define PID_DVB_SIT 0x001f
#define PID_NULL 0x1fff
#define PID_UNSPEC 0xffff
#define PES_STREAM_VIDEO 0xE0
#define PES_STREAM_AUDIO 0xC0
#define ES_TYPE_MPEG1V 0x01
#define ES_TYPE_MPEG2V 0x02
#define ES_TYPE_MPEG1A 0x03
#define ES_TYPE_MPEG2A 0x04
#define ES_TYPE_PRIVATESECTS 0x05
#define ES_TYPE_PRIVATEDATA 0x06
#define ES_TYPE_MHEG 0x07
#define ES_TYPE_DSMCC 0x08
#define ES_TYPE_AUXILIARY 0x09
#define ES_TYPE_DSMCC_ENCAP 0x0a
#define ES_TYPE_DSMCC_UN 0x0b
#define ES_TYPE_AAC 0x0f
#define ES_TYPE_MPEG4V 0x10
#define ES_TYPE_LATM_AAC 0x11
#define ES_TYPE_MPEG4_GENERIC 0x12
/* Unknown 0x13 */
#define ES_TYPE_DSMCC_DOWNLOAD 0x14
/* Unknown 0x15 */
/* Unknown 0x16 */
/* Unknown 0x17 */
/* Unknown 0x1a */
#define ES_TYPE_H264 0x1b
#define ES_TYPE_DIGICIPHER2V 0x80
#define ES_TYPE_AC3 0x81
#define ES_TYPE_DCA 0x82
#define ES_TYPE_LPCM 0x83
#define ES_TYPE_SDDS 0x84
#define ES_TYPE_ATSC_PROGID 0x85
#define ES_TYPE_DTSHD 0x86
#define ES_TYPE_EAC3 0x87
#define ES_TYPE_DTS 0x8a
#define ES_TYPE_DVB_SLICE 0x90
#define ES_TYPE_AC3B 0x91
#define ES_TYPE_SUBTITLE 0x92
#define ES_TYPE_SDDSB 0x94
#define ES_TYPE_MSCODEC 0xa0
#define ES_TYPE_DIRAC 0xd1
#define ES_TYPE_VC1 0xea
#define TID_PAT 0x00
#define TID_CAT 0x01
#define TID_PMT 0x02
#define TID_DVB_NIT 0x40
#define TID_DVB_ONIT 0x41
#define DESC_VIDEO 0x02
#define DESC_AUDIO 0x03
#define DESC_HIERARCHY 0x04
#define DESC_REGISTRATION 0x05
#define DESC_DSA 0x06 /* data stream alignment */
#define DESC_TBG 0x07 /* target background grid */
#define DESC_VIDEOWINDOW 0x08
#define DESC_CA 0x09
#define DESC_LANGUAGE 0x0a
#define DESC_CLOCK 0x0b
#define DESC_MBU 0x0c /* multiplex buffer utilisation */
#define DESC_COPYRIGHT 0x0d
#define DESC_MAXBITRATE 0x0e
#define PT_UNSPEC 0
#define PT_SECTIONS 1
#define PT_PES 2
#define PT_DATA 3
#define PT_NULL 4
#define PST_UNSPEC 0
#define PST_VIDEO 1
#define PST_AUDIO 2
#define PST_INTERACTIVE 3
#define PST_CC 4
#define PST_IP 5
#define PST_SI 6
#define PST_NI 7
#ifdef BIG_ENDIAN
#undef BIG_ENDIAN
#endif
#pragma pack(push, 1) // 1字节对齐
typedef struct TSHdrFixedPart
{
uint8 sync_byte:8;
#ifdef BIG_ENDIAN
uint8 transport_error_indicator:1;
uint8 payload_unit_start_indicator:1;
uint8 transport_priority:1;
uint8 pid12_8:5;
uint8 pid7_0:8;
uint8 transport_scrambling_control:2;
uint8 adaptation_field_control:2;
uint8 continuity_counter:4;
#else // LITTLE_ENDIAN
uint8 pid12_8:5;
uint8 transport_priority:1;
uint8 payload_unit_start_indicator:1;
uint8 transport_error_indicator:1;
uint8 pid7_0:8;
uint8 continuity_counter:4;
uint8 adaptation_field_control:2;
uint8 transport_scrambling_control:2;
#endif
}TSHdrFixedPart;
typedef struct AdaptFixedPart
{
uint8 adaptation_field_length:8;
#ifdef BIG_ENDIAN
uint8 discontinuity_indicator:1;
uint8 random_access_indicator:1;
uint8 elementary_stream_priority_indicator:1;
uint8 PCR_flag:1;
uint8 OPCR_flag:1;
uint8 splicing_point_flag:1;
uint8 transport_private_data_flag:1;
uint8 adaptation_field_extension_flag:1;
#else // LITTLE_ENDIAN
uint8 adaptation_field_extension_flag:1;
uint8 transport_private_data_flag:1;
uint8 splicing_point_flag:1;
uint8 OPCR_flag:1;
uint8 PCR_flag:1;
uint8 elementary_stream_priority_indicator:1;
uint8 random_access_indicator:1;
uint8 discontinuity_indicator:1;
#endif
}AdaptFixedPart;
typedef struct PCR
{
uint8 pcr_base32_25:8;
uint8 pcr_base24_17:8;
uint8 pcr_base16_9:8;
uint8 pcr_base8_1:8;
#ifdef BIG_ENDIAN
uint8 pcr_base0:1;
uint8 reserved:6;
uint8 pcr_extension8:1;
#else // LITTLE_ENDIAN
uint8 pcr_extension8:1;
uint8 reserved:6;
uint8 pcr_base0:1;
#endif
uint8 pcr_extension7_0:8;
}PCR;
typedef struct PESHdrFixedPart
{
uint32 packet_start_code_prefix:24;
uint8 stream_id:8;
uint16 PES_packet_length:16;
}PESHdrFixedPart;
typedef struct OptionPESHdrFixedPart
{
#ifdef BIG_ENDIAN
uint8 fix_2bits:2; // "10"
uint8 PES_scrambling_control:2; // "00" Not scramble; "01","10","11" User-defined
uint8 PES_priority:1;
uint8 data_alignment_indicator:1;
uint8 copyright:1;
uint8 original_or_copy:1;
uint8 PTS_DTS_flags:2;
uint8 ESCR_flag:1;
uint8 ES_rate_flag:1;
uint8 DSM_trick_mode_flag:1;
uint8 additional_copy_info_flag:1;
uint8 PES_CRC_flag:1;
uint8 PES_extension_flag:1;
#else // LITTLE_ENDIAN
uint8 original_or_copy:1;
uint8 copyright:1;
uint8 data_alignment_indicator:1;
uint8 PES_priority:1;
uint8 PES_scrambling_control:2;
uint8 fix_10:2;
uint8 PES_extension_flag:1;
uint8 PES_CRC_flag:1;
uint8 additional_copy_info_flag:1;
uint8 DSM_trick_mode_flag:1;
uint8 ES_rate_flag:1;
uint8 ESCR_flag:1;
uint8 PTS_DTS_flags:2;
#endif
uint8 PES_Hdr_data_length:8;
}OptionPESHdrFixedPart;
typedef struct PTS_DTS
{
#ifdef BIG_ENDIAN
uint8 fix_4bits:4; // PTS is "0010" or "0011", DTS is "0001"
uint8 ts32_30:3;
uint8 marker_bit1:1;
uint8 ts29_22:8;
uint8 ts21_15:7;
uint8 marker_bit2:1;
uint8 ts14_7:8;
uint8 ts6_0:7;
uint8 marker_bit3:1;
#else // LITTLE_ENDIAN
uint8 marker_bit1:1;
uint8 ts32_30:3;
uint8 fix_4bits:4; // PTS is "0010" or "0011", DTS is "0001"
uint8 ts29_22:8;
uint8 marker_bit2:1;
uint8 ts21_15:7;
uint8 ts14_7:8;
uint8 marker_bit3:1;
uint8 ts6_0:7;
#endif
}PTS_DTS;
typedef struct PATHdrFixedPart
{
uint8 table_id:8;
#ifdef BIG_ENDIAN
uint8 section_syntax_indicator:1;
uint8 zero_bit:1; // '0'
uint8 reserved1:2;
uint8 section_length11_8:4;
uint8 section_length7_0:8;
uint16 transport_stream_id:16;
uint8 reserved2:2;
uint8 version_number:5;
uint8 current_next_indicator:1;
#else // LITTLE_ENDIAN
uint8 section_length11_8:4;
uint8 reserved1:2;
uint8 zero_bit:1; // '0'
uint8 section_syntax_indicator:1;
uint8 section_length7_0:8;
uint16 transport_stream_id:16;
uint8 current_next_indicator:1;
uint8 version_number:5;
uint8 reserved2:2;
#endif
uint8 section_number:8;
uint8 last_section_number:8;
}PATHdrFixedPart;
typedef struct PATSubSection
{
uint16 program_number:16;
#ifdef BIG_ENDIAN
uint8 reserved:3;
uint8 pid12_8:5;
#else // LITTLE_ENDIAN
uint8 pid12_8:5;
uint8 reserved:3;
#endif
uint8 pid7_0:8;
}PATSubSection;
typedef struct CATHdrFixedPart
{
uint8 table_id:8;
#ifdef BIG_ENDIAN
uint8 section_syntax_indicator:1;
uint8 zero_bit:1; // '0'
uint8 reserved1:2;
uint8 section_length11_8:4;
uint8 section_length7_0:8;
uint16 reserved2:16;
uint8 reserved3:2;
uint8 version_number:5;
uint8 current_next_indicator:1;
#else // LITTLE_ENDIAN
uint8 section_length11_8:4;
uint8 reserved1:2;
uint8 zero_bit:1; // '0'
uint8 section_syntax_indicator:1;
uint8 section_length7_0:8;
uint16 reserved2:16;
uint8 current_next_indicator:1;
uint8 version_number:5;
uint8 reserved3:2;
#endif
uint8 section_number:8;
uint8 last_section_number:8;
}CATHdrFixedPart;
typedef struct PMTHdrFixedPart
{
uint8 table_id:8;
#ifdef BIG_ENDIAN
uint8 section_syntax_indicator:1;
uint8 zero_bit:1; // '0'
uint8 reserved1:2;
uint8 section_length11_8:4;
uint8 section_length7_0:8;
uint16 program_number:16;
uint8 reserved2:2;
uint8 version_number:5;
uint8 current_next_indicator:1;
uint8 section_number:8;
uint8 last_section_number:8;
uint8 reserved3:3;
uint8 PCR_PID12_8:5;
uint8 PCR_PID7_0:8;
uint8 reserved4:4;
uint8 program_info_length11_8:4;
uint8 program_info_length7_0:8;
#else // LITTLE_ENDIAN
uint8 section_length11_8:4;
uint8 reserved1:2;
uint8 zero_bit:1; // '0'
uint8 section_syntax_indicator:1;
uint8 section_length7_0:8;
uint16 transport_stream_id:16;
uint8 current_next_indicator:1;
uint8 version_number:5;
uint8 reserved2:2;
uint8 section_number:8;
uint8 last_section_number:8;
uint8 PCR_PID12_8:5;
uint8 reserved3:3;
uint8 PCR_PID7_0:8;
uint8 program_info_length11_8:4;
uint8 reserved4:4;
uint8 program_info_length7_0:8;
#endif
}PMTHdrFixedPart;
typedef struct PMTSubSectionFixedPart
{
uint8 stream_type:8;
#ifdef BIG_ENDIAN
uint8 reserved1:3;
uint8 elementaryPID12_8:5;
uint8 elementaryPID7_0:8;
uint8 reserved2:4;
uint8 ES_info_lengh11_8:4;
uint8 ES_info_lengh7_0:8;
#else // LITTLE_ENDIAN
uint8 elementaryPID12_8:5;
uint8 reserved1:3;
uint8 elementaryPID7_0:8;
uint8 ES_info_lengh11_8:4;
uint8 reserved2:4;
uint8 ES_info_lengh7_0:8;
#endif
}PMTSubSectionFixedPart;
#pragma pack(pop) //恢复对齐状态
#endif //__TS_TYPES__
